This charming church serves the small community on Bryher and, in pasts times, also that of Samson.
Built in 1742, in was extended in 1882 and 1897. As well as the nave, there is a small sanctuary and a squat tower with a pyramidal cap. Both the roof and the 19th windows have been replaced in recent years, the new windows being by a local artist, Oriel Hicks.
